    Scientists reported Wednesday that they had taken a significant step toward altering the fundamental alphabet of life - creating an organism with an expanded artificial genetic code in its DNA. The accomplishment might eventually lead to organisms that can make medicines or industrial products that cells with only the natural genetic code cannot. The scientists behind the work at the Scripps Research Institute have already formed a company to try to use the technique to develop new antibiotics, vaccines and other products, though a lot more work needs to be done before this is practical. The work also gives some support to the concept that life can exist elsewhere in the universe using genetics different from those on Earth. "This is the first time that you have had a living cell manage an alien genetic alphabet," said Steven A. Benner, a researcher in the field at the Foundation for Applied Molecular Evolution in Gainesville, Fla., who was not involved in the new work. But the research, published online by the journal Nature, is bound to raise safety concerns and questions about whether humans are playing God. The new paper could intensify calls for greater regulation of the budding field known as synthetic biology, which involves the creation of biological systems intended for specific purposes.

    An international team of scientists has made a major step forward in our understanding of how enzymes 'edit' genes, paving the way for correcting genetic diseases in patients. Researchers at the Universities of Bristol, Münster and the Lithuanian Institute of Biotechnology have observed the process by which a class of enzymes called CRISPR - pronounced 'crisper' - bind and alter the structure of DNA. The results, published in the Proceedings of the National Academy of Sciences (PNAS) today, provide a vital piece of the puzzle if these genome editing tools are ultimately going to be used to correct genetic diseases in humans. CRISPR enzymes were first discovered in bacteria in the 1980s as an immune defence used by bacteria against invading viruses. Scientists have more recenty shown that one type of CRISPR enzyme - Cas9 - can be used to edit the human genome - the complete set of genetic information for humans. Did you know??     What if your cell phone didn't come with a battery? Imagine, instead, if the material from which your phone was built was a battery. The promise of strong load-bearing materials that can also work as batteries represents something of a holy grail for engineers. And in a letter published online in Nano Letters last week, a team of researchers from Vanderbilt University describes what it says is a breakthrough in turning that dream into an electrocharged reality. The researchers etched nanopores into silicon layers, which were infused with a polyethylene oxide-ionic liquid composite and coated with an atomically thin layer of carbon. In doing so, they created small but strong supercapacitor battery systems, which stored electricity in a solid electrolyte, instead of using corrosive chemical liquids found in traditional batteries.

    Molecular biologist Nancy Hopkins, the Amgen, Inc., Professor of Biology at the Massachusetts Institute of Technology, recalled personal trials as a female scientist and challenged graduates to overcome invisible barriers in an inspiring Baccalaureate Address to the Class of 2014 at Marsh Chapel Sunday morning. She mentioned some of the great breakthroughs of the last 50 years: the internet, the Higgs particle, and notably, the "discovery of unconscious biases and the extent to which stereotypes about gender, race, sexual orientation, socioeconomic status, and age deprive people of equal opportunity in the workplace and equal justice in society." Hopkins was later awarded an honorary Doctor of Science at BU's 141st Commencement. She spoke before a packed audience at Marsh Chapel and was enthusiastically applauded for her remarks. President Robert A. Brown, University Provost Jean Morrison, Marsh Chapel Dean Robert Hill, and Emma Rehard (CAS'14) also addressed the graduates and their families. Scott Allen Jarrett (CFA'99,'08), director of music at Marsh Chapel, led the Marsh Chapel Choir in "Clarissima" and "For the Beauty of the Earth." Early in her career, Hopkins worked in the lab of James Watson, the codiscoverer of the structure of DNA. She earned a PhD at Harvard and became a faculty member at MIT, working at the Center for Cancer Research. There, she focused her research on RNA tumor viruses, then considered to be a likely cause for many cancers in humans. Hopkins also studied developmental genetics in zebra fish, and helped to design the first successful method for making insertional mutagenesis work in a vertebrate model.
